Problems solved by technology

The selection of the initial value should be considered for the newly added control variable, and the solution of the Newton-Raphson method is strongly dependent on the initial value of the variable, so the simultaneous solution method also has the problems of slowing down the convergence speed and degrading the convergence reliability
At the same time, the expression of the newly added control objective equation is quite different from that of the classic power flow equation, and the modified equation may be ill-conditioned under certain conditions

Abstract

The invention discloses a method and system for calculating an AC-DC hybrid power flow of a DC layered structure. The method comprises the following steps: completing the state calculation of a DC network according to the control mode of a converter station, causing the connection point of the DC network and the AC network to be equivalent to a power node, and calculating the flow using a Newton-Raphson method. The method and system not only overcome the problem of convergence deterioration caused by alternating iterations of the alternating iterative method, but also avoids the problems of initial value selection and Jacobian matrix scale expansion caused by the simultaneous method, and have double advantages of good convergence and less memory occupation during the iterative process.

technical field [0001] The invention relates to a method and a system for calculating an AC-DC hybrid power flow considering a DC layered structure. Background technique [0002] There are two main types of methods for AC / DC hybrid power system power flow: alternating iteration method and simultaneous solution method: [0003] 1) The main advantage of the alternate iteration method is that the original node admittance matrix and Jacobian matrix are not changed in the main iteration, only the node power balance equation needs to be slightly modified, and it is easy to combine with the original power flow algorithm and realize programming.
